Summary:
This book presents the emerging technologies of Industry 4.0. It describes the growing trend towards automation and data exchange in the manufacturing industry, with a focus on the internet of things (IoT), the industrial internet of things (IIoT), cyberphysical systems (CPS), smart factories, cloud computing, cognitive computing, and artificial intelligence.
